Background technique
Agstone is with calcium carbonate white powder substance as main component, and application range is very extensive, can be used to
Manufacture calcium carbide, liquid alkaline, bleaching liquor, bleaching powder, it can also be used to the purposes such as tan leather, metallurgy, purification waste water, in production agstone
It needs for broken lime stone to be transported in existing pulverizer in the process and crush, still, usually can during transportation
Encounter following problems:
1, it is conveyed usually using the mode of hand stock, due to being open charging, is had in transmission process
A large amount of powder floats in the sky to pollute to ambient enviroment, and be easy the staff being fed accidentally inhale so as to cause
The discomfort of own bodies;2, when hand stock, it usually needs personnel are shoveled at the charging into pulverizer by spader, and single adds
Doses is often difficult to control, and is shoveled among when expecting every time and be will appear the neutral gear phase, to the case where cannot uniformly conveying occur.

When work;
S1, by feedstock transportation to funnel frame 1, be lifted up switch gate 22, pass through work drive motor 51 drive rotation cam
53, rotation cam 54 synchronizes rotation;
The drive of rotation cam 53 of S2, rotary state convey slideway 41 and are vibrated up and down, to will convey on slideway 41
Raw material vibrating transportation to the right, the rotation cam 54 of rotary state, which drives, pushes frame 63 to carry out side-to-side vibrations, to push conveying
Raw material on slideway 41 moves right;
S3,27 counterclockwise movement of scraper plate being driven by driving motor 23, the scraper plate 27 of motion state scrapes to the right raw material,
Raw material is transferred out from the right end of installing frame 21.
